Advantages: - High resolution provides accurate and detailed measurements - Low power consumption extends battery life in portable devices - Programmable gain amplifier allows for signal amplification and conditioning - I2C interface simplifies communication with microcontrollers
Disadvantages: - Limited input voltage range of ±2.048V - Relatively slow conversion rate compared to some other ADCs - Requires external components for proper operation
The MCP3422A0-E/MS is based on the delta-sigma modulation technique. It converts analog signals into digital data by oversampling the input signal and using a digital filter to remove noise. The onboard programmable gain amplifier allows for amplification and conditioning of the analog signal before conversion. The converted digital data is then transmitted via the I2C interface for further processing.

Question: What is the maximum sampling rate of MCP3422A0-E/MS?
Answer: The maximum sampling rate of MCP3422A0-E/MS is 240 samples per second.
Question: Can MCP3422A0-E/MS operate at different gain settings?
Answer: Yes, MCP3422A0-E/MS can operate at gain settings of 1, 2, 4, or 8.
Question: What is the resolution of MCP3422A0-E/MS?
Answer: The resolution of MCP3422A0-E/MS is 18 bits.
Question: Does MCP3422A0-E/MS support I2C communication?
Answer: Yes, MCP3422A0-E/MS supports I2C communication interface.
Question: What is the operating voltage range for MCP3422A0-E/MS?
Answer: The operating voltage range for MCP3422A0-E/MS is 2.7V to 5.5V.
